Education and Training

Level 3

Course Overview

The Level 3 Award in Education and Training (AET) course is a teaching qualification in the Further Education (FE) sector, designed to prepare a person who is new to teaching or training, or considering taking on a role as a teacher or trainer. It is the first of a number of qualifications that have been designed to give a teacher or trainer the ‘building blocks’ to become more skilled in their role. 

The course consists of 3 units:

  • Understanding Roles, Responsibilities and Relationships in Education and Training
  • Using and Understanding Inclusive Teaching and Learning Approaches in Education and Training
  • Understanding Assessment in Education and Training

Course Requirements

There are no specific requirements for this course, however, learners should be capable of studying at Level 3. 

  • Maths and English at Level 2 are desirable as well as a satisfactory level of IT skills.

FAQs

How long is this course?

The duration depends on the delivery model.  The distance learning course is flexible and self-paced and usually takes around 6 months to complete. The classroom course is delivered over 5 days, and it takes learners roughly 2 weeks – 1 month to submit all assessments.

What can I progress onto from this course?

On completion of this course you could progress to the Level 4 Certificate in Education and Training or the Level 3 Certificate in Assessing Vocational Achievement.
